Job Description
The District is recruiting for an After-School Program Lead Teacher. The Lead Teacher is a certificated person who assists the Director of Expanded Learning Opportunities (ELO) in duty areas designated by the Principal and Director of Expanded Learning Opportunities in the administration of the FUESD Afterschool Program. These duties are in addition to a teacher's primary responsibilities.

Example of Duties
Assists the Director of Expanded Learning Opportunities in supervising and developing the FUESD Afterschool Programs.
Assists with the orientation of after-school teachers and staff.
Coordinates and communicates with the Director of the ELO regarding facility needs and program assignments using campus classrooms.
Works with students, parents/guardians, and teachers to coordinate the ELO Afterschool Program.
Conducts parent meetings and makes phone calls as needed.
Provides training to the FUESD Afterschool staff on PBIS, school-wide expectations, and disciplinary issues.
Manages the school site's after-school dashboard, which includes student rosters and instructors' classes for all after-school enrichment and intervention classes.
Collect and review staff timesheets for processing and submission.
Collaborates with community partners and external vendors to support the FUESD Afterschool Program.
Performs other duties as may be assigned.
Qualifications
California Administrative Services Credential or be enrolled in an approved program leading to an Administrative Services Credential is preferred. A minimum of three (3) years of successful teaching experience with exemplary evaluations and a First Aid/CPR certificate.
